Automation Overview
- Introduction to Automation
Automation is the use of technology to perform tasks with minimal human intervention, enabling processes to be more efficient, accurate, and scalable. Automation is transforming industries by handling repetitive tasks, freeing up human resources for more strategic activities, and ensuring consistent outcomes. It is applied across various sectors, including manufacturing, software development, marketing, and customer service.
- Key Features
Workflow Automation:
Streamlines multi-step processes, linking tasks across different tools and systems to eliminate manual steps and improve efficiency.AI and Machine Learning Integration:
Enhances automation with smart algorithms that can adapt, optimize, and predict outcomes, making processes more intelligent over time.Data Management and Processing:
Automatically collects, processes, and analyzes data, allowing for rapid, data-driven decision-making without manual handling.Trigger-Based Actions:
Executes specific actions based on pre-defined triggers (e.g., sending notifications upon task completion) to keep processes running smoothly and minimize delays.Integration with Third-Party Applications:
Connects seamlessly with other platforms like CRM, ERP, and project management tools, ensuring data flows smoothly across systems.
- Benefits of Using Automation
Increased Productivity:
Automates repetitive tasks, allowing teams to focus on high-value activities that drive innovation and growth.Reduced Human Error:
Ensures accuracy and consistency by automating data entry, calculations, and other detail-oriented tasks.Scalability:
Easily handles increased workload without requiring additional resources, making it ideal for growing businesses.Cost Savings:
Reduces operational costs by cutting down on manual labor, thereby lowering overhead and boosting profitability.Enhanced Customer Experience:
Improves response times and service accuracy, creating a more satisfying experience for customers.
- Use Cases
Manufacturing:
Automates production lines, quality checks, and inventory management, ensuring efficiency and precision in operations.Marketing and Sales:
Manages customer communications, lead scoring, and campaign analytics, allowing teams to focus on strategy rather than repetitive tasks.Human Resources:
Streamlines processes like onboarding, payroll management, and employee performance tracking, enhancing the employee experience and reducing administrative workload.Finance:
Handles tasks like invoicing, expense reporting, and budgeting, ensuring financial accuracy and compliance with minimal manual intervention.
